Energy storage materials belong to innovative class of materials that underlies the transition to a global low-carbon economy. Given that the materials are designed to cover certain energy applications, their desired properties determine the possibilities, potential, reliability, and limitations of the technology. That is why materials with desired properties are more than simple components of the energy technologies. The development of innovative materials for a given application is closely related to our ability to obtain insights into complex relations between the method of synthesis and material’s properties.

This Special Issue addresses the relationships between methods of synthesis and materials’ properties. The main topics are related with the application of materials:

  • electrochemical energy storage;
  • thermal energy storage and conversion;
  • fuel cells and hydrogen;
  • carbon capture and storage.
